wordpress查询表单数据
创始人
2024-12-06 02:09:41
0

WordPress 查询表单数据的深入指南

引言

在WordPress网站中,查询表单是一个常见且实用的功能,它允许用户提交数据到后台,以便管理员或网站所有者进行进一步的处理。本文将深入探讨如何在WordPress中创建查询表单,并展示如何有效地获取和存储这些数据。

为什么需要查询表单?

查询表单可以用于多种目的,例如:

wordpress查询表单数据

  • 收集用户反馈
  • 搜索数据库中的内容
  • 提交订单或预约
  • 收集市场调研数据

通过合理使用查询表单,可以增强用户体验,提高数据收集效率。

创建查询表单

1. 选择合适的插件

WordPress中有许多插件可以帮助你创建查询表单。以下是一些受欢迎的插件:

  • Contact Form 7
  • WPForms
  • Formidable Forms
  • Jetpack Contact Forms

选择一个插件并根据你的需求安装它。

2. 设计表单

安装并激活插件后,你可以开始设计你的查询表单。大多数表单插件都提供拖放编辑器,让你轻松添加文本框、下拉菜单、单选按钮、复选框等表单元素。

3. 配置表单设置

在设计表单的同时,确保配置以下设置:

  • 表单名称:为你的表单命名,以便于识别。
  • 邮件通知:设置接收表单数据的邮箱地址。
  • 邮件内容:自定义邮件通知的内容。
  • 表单动作:设置表单提交后的行为,例如跳转到特定页面。

获取表单数据

一旦表单被提交,你需要一种方法来获取存储这些数据。以下是一些常见的方法:

1. 查看邮件通知

提交表单后,你会在设置的邮箱地址中收到一封包含所有数据的邮件。

2. 使用插件功能

许多表单插件都提供将数据保存到数据库的功能。例如:

  • WPForms:可以将数据保存到自定义表格中。
  • Formidable Forms:允许你创建数据库表格并自动填充数据。

3. 编写自定义代码

如果你熟悉PHP和WordPress,可以编写自定义代码来处理和存储数据。以下是一个简单的示例:

if (isset($_POST['my_form'])) {
    $name = sanitize_text_field($_POST['name']);
    $email = sanitize_email($_POST['email']);
    $message = sanitize_text_field($_POST['message']);

    // 将数据保存到数据库或执行其他操作
}

安全与验证

在处理用户提交的数据时,确保采取以下措施:

  • 数据验证:确保所有输入都经过验证,以防止SQL注入和其他安全威胁。
  • 限制表单提交:使用插件或代码限制同一IP地址在短时间内提交表单的次数。
  • 使用HTTPS:确保你的网站使用HTTPS协议,以保护用户数据的安全。

结论

在WordPress中创建和查询表单数据是提高网站交互性和数据收集效率的有效方式。通过选择合适的插件、设计合适的表单、获取和存储数据,以及确保数据安全,你可以构建一个功能强大且用户友好的查询表单系统。希望本文能为你提供必要的指导和灵感。

相关内容

热门资讯

长征五号B遥一运载火箭顺利通过... 2020年1月19日,长征五号B遥一运载火箭顺利通过了航天科技集团有限公司在北京组织的出厂评审。目前...
9所本科高校获教育部批准 6所... 1月19日,教育部官方网站发布了关于批准设置本科高等学校的函件,9所由省级人民政府申报设置的本科高等...
9所本科高校获教育部批准 6所... 1月19日,教育部官方网站发布了关于批准设置本科高等学校的函件,9所由省级人民政府申报设置的本科高等...
湖北省黄冈市人大常委会原党组成... 据湖北省纪委监委消息:经湖北省纪委监委审查调查,黄冈市人大常委会原党组成员、副主任吴美景丧失理想信念...
《大江大河2》剧组暂停拍摄工作... 搜狐娱乐讯 今天下午,《大江大河2》剧组发布公告,称当前防控疫情是重中之重的任务,为了避免剧组工作人...